In the first 60 minutes, I couldn't smell any difference with the best will in the world. Both start really well and fill the room. Also really, really close to each other. Sure, I'm not a sniffer, but I would have expected significantly more differences.
After 1.5 hours, however, one of the two performed a little better...drum roll...it's the side effect of Initio. Even clearer after 2 hours. Much finer, a little woodier, smoky and also a very pleasant cherry. However, the After Effect doesn't have to hide. You can just smell that it is a little more synthetic. The light cherry note is a little more and the smokiness a little artificial, BUT NOT BAD! After 3 hours, the AE calms down a bit and the SE is simply more perceptible.
Both still very similar to each other.
After 6 hours the AE runs out of breath and after 8 hours the SE.
Conclusion: Yes, the After Effect is a very well-made dupe of the Side Effect. The gradient is not so fine, the durability is not so long, but for a 40 you can't go wrong here (unless you hate dupes!).
